Here are the four reasons why purchasing is essential for your business success in Saudi Arabia. Let’s look at each in detail.
Purchasing has a direct impact on profitability, and effective procurement can mean the difference between tight margins and sustainable growth. By negotiating favorable contracts, consolidating suppliers, and minimizing waste, businesses can reduce costs without compromising quality.
In the Saudi market, cost savings also free up resources for reinvestment into innovation, workforce development, or expansion projects.
With Vision 2030 encouraging companies to be more competitive and self-reliant, procurement efficiency ensures that businesses not only survive in a competitive environment but thrive with healthier balance sheets and stronger long-term prospects.
Purchasing is not only about saving money; it’s also about driving operational efficiency. Streamlined procurement systems minimize bottlenecks, expedite supplier approvals, and give businesses greater control over production timelines.
This directly boosts productivity and ensures smoother collaboration across departments.
Automated procurement platforms play a vital role in enhancing efficiency by reducing manual work, cutting human error, and providing real-time insights. By digitizing purchasing processes, companies become more agile and competitive, ensuring they can meet growing demands and deliver projects with greater speed and precision.
Every business faces risks, but purchasing is where you can prevent many of them from becoming critical issues. Strong procurement practices help you diversify suppliers, secure dependable contracts, and avoid vulnerabilities from market fluctuations or global disruptions.
This resilience ensures that projects and operations can continue even in uncertain conditions.
By sourcing locally, businesses not only strengthen their own resilience but also contribute to reducing dependence on imports. This enhances supply security, ensuring that companies remain more secure and adaptable in the face of changing global conditions.
Purchasing decisions shape the long-term trajectory of a company. By aligning procurement strategies with innovation, sustainability, and strong supplier partnerships, businesses can open new opportunities and build a competitive edge. It’s not just about supporting current operations; it’s about enabling future growth.
Procurement is closely tied to Vision 2030’s push for local supplier development and sustainable sourcing. Companies that prioritize these areas not only enhance their reputations but also secure advantages in fast-growing industries.
By making purchasing a strategic function, businesses position themselves as partners in the Kingdom’s transformation while fueling their own expansion.

Purchasing is no longer just about securing goods and services at the lowest cost; it has evolved into a technology-driven, strategic function. In Saudi Arabia, procurement is becoming smarter, more transparent, and closely aligned with efficiency and sustainability goals.
From artificial intelligence (AI) and data analytics to eco-friendly sourcing strategies, modern purchasing practices are enabling Saudi businesses to enhance operational efficiency, build resilience, and generate long-term value.
Let’s look at the key trends and technologies that are transforming purchasing in the Saudi market today:
Digital technologies are redefining the way Saudi businesses approach purchasing. AI-powered systems analyze supplier data, forecast demand, and identify risks before they disrupt operations. Automation streamlines routine tasks like invoice approvals and supplier onboarding, reducing delays and human errors.
Sustainability is no longer optional in procurement; it is a strategic priority. Saudi Vision 2030 emphasizes sustainable growth, and procurement practices are adapting accordingly. Companies are increasingly sourcing from local and eco-friendly suppliers, reducing carbon footprints, and ensuring compliance with green standards.
This shift strengthens business reputation, aligns with government regulations, and supports the Kingdom’s transition to a diversified, sustainable economy.
Enterprise Resource Planning (ERP) systems are transforming procurement management in Saudi Arabia. Solutions such as HAL ERP, designed to meet local business needs, integrate purchasing with finance, inventory, and operations, giving companies greater visibility and control.
Procurement automation through ERP not only saves time but also reduces costs, increases accuracy, and enables real-time decision-making. This is particularly important in sectors like construction, healthcare, and retail, where supply chain speed and precision are critical.

The shift toward automation is accelerating in Saudi Arabia. Around 10% of enterprises in the Kingdom have already adopted e-procurement systems as their primary tool for managing supply chain and purchasing activities.
Moreover, the Saudi procurement-as-a-service market generated USD 143.8 million in 2024 and is projected to grow to USD 542.7 million by 2033, reflecting a strong appetite for digital solutions in the market.
